The Top Job Roles for Architects in Bangalore
When it comes to job roles, Bangalore offers a diverse range of options for architects, depending on their skills, experience, and interests. Some of the most popular job roles in this city include:
1. Architectural Designer
This role involves designing and developing blueprints, sketches, and models for various types of buildings and structures, based on the client's requirements and specifications. The ideal candidate should have strong creative and technical skills, as well as a deep understanding of the latest design trends and tools.
2. Project Manager
In this role, the architect is responsible for overseeing the entire project lifecycle, from planning and budgeting to implementation and delivery. The project manager should have excellent leadership and communication skills, as well as a solid knowledge of project management methodologies and tools.
3. Interior Designer
This role focuses on designing and decorating the interiors of buildings and spaces, such as homes, offices, and retail outlets. The interior designer should have a keen eye for aesthetics, as well as a good understanding of the functional and ergonomic aspects of interior design.
4. Landscape Architect
In this role, the architect is responsible for designing and planning outdoor spaces, such as parks, gardens, and public areas. The landscape architect should have a strong knowledge of plants, materials, and environmental factors, as well as a good understanding of the cultural and social aspects of landscape design.
The Skills and Qualifications Required for Architects in Bangalore
To succeed in the competitive job market in Bangalore, architects need to possess a range of skills and qualifications, such as:
1. Technical Skills
Architects should have a strong understanding of the technical aspects of building design, such as structural engineering, construction materials, and building codes. They should also be proficient in using various software tools and technologies, such as AutoCAD, SketchUp, Revit, and 3D modeling software.
2. Creative Skills
Architects should have a strong creative vision and the ability to translate their ideas into tangible designs and models. They should also have a good sense of aesthetics, proportion, and color, as well as the ability to balance form and function in their designs.
3. Communication Skills
Architects should be able to communicate effectively with clients, contractors, and other stakeholders, both verbally and in writing. They should also be able to present their ideas and designs in a clear and persuasive manner, and to collaborate with other team members in a constructive and positive way.
4. Qualifications
Most employers in Bangalore require architects to have a Bachelor's or Master's degree in architecture from a recognized institution, as well as a license from the Council of Architecture (COA) in India. Some employers may also prefer candidates with additional certifications or training in specific areas of architecture, such as sustainable design or urban planning.
